Commit Graph

48360 Commits

Author SHA1 Message Date
Chaohui Wang
bfc811f384 Merge "Fix Data Saver page crashed when rotate" into udc-dev am: bf9ba71cba am: 49eebbcfe6
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/22898015

Change-Id: Ie6a5ba59a28f40f7bfa0c9b9a33029634b011fd9
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-05-02 14:28:00 +00:00
Treehugger Robot
1ff9d7cc34 Merge "Fix battery percentage is inconsistent in settings" into udc-dev am: 3b60e2a9c3 am: f6ba37e583
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/22948142

Change-Id: Ifbc2f697f1c01683bab16227d5a02e9c3044575b
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-05-02 14:24:35 +00:00
Chaohui Wang
bf9ba71cba Merge "Fix Data Saver page crashed when rotate" into udc-dev 2023-05-02 09:50:17 +00:00
ykhung
0288b6d4af Fix battery percentage is inconsistent in settings
Fix: 275217364
Test: make test RunSettingsRoboTests
Change-Id: I16dd772aacaea3f8ddb6da579adb033124e3dbb7
2023-05-02 11:58:08 +08:00
Treehugger Robot
6ddc836713 Merge "Support incompatible charger state in the Settings main page" into udc-dev am: 65efc1f45e am: 3bef26666f
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/22954539

Change-Id: Id0f3d8dcf8c127f2209f3567d10149fa37556290
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-05-02 03:14:05 +00:00
Treehugger Robot
65efc1f45e Merge "Support incompatible charger state in the Settings main page" into udc-dev 2023-05-02 01:51:10 +00:00
Grace Cheng
1fdc38fe4d Merge "Prevent NPE on deleting fingerprint in Settings" into udc-dev am: 8b36777419 am: 9ae24317d2
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/22911556

Change-Id: I3238e6d0e7681f121cabdba444be6ac0a4a10bc5
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-05-02 00:29:42 +00:00
Grace Cheng
8b36777419 Merge "Prevent NPE on deleting fingerprint in Settings" into udc-dev 2023-05-01 22:40:59 +00:00
Kweku Adams
a8498b14f9 Merge "Use string notifications_disabled instead of off" into udc-dev am: 83c04b32d1 am: bdf3cb8df9
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/22938598

Change-Id: I1cbd994f1906de6e5e6eea57bb7adb89f0a925f1
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-05-01 16:57:21 +00:00
ykhung
09c1a4a850 Support incompatible charger state in the Settings main page
https://screenshot.googleplex.com/9af4YCnCCjKHCFY

Bug: 271775549
Test: make test RunSettingsRoboTests
Change-Id: I6562e1b48a85ceceb20389ed87e55e0093040be2
2023-05-02 00:04:01 +08:00
Kweku Adams
83c04b32d1 Merge "Use string notifications_disabled instead of off" into udc-dev 2023-05-01 15:37:22 +00:00
Florian Mayer
d8526d4c9c Merge "Fix typo in MemtagHelper" into udc-dev am: d7bbff0041 am: b112a868a8
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/22931417

Change-Id: Iaed6b8d9d579e2bb5f96bdb427ed3779933dd731
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-05-01 11:41:54 +00:00
Florian Mayer
d7bbff0041 Merge "Fix typo in MemtagHelper" into udc-dev 2023-05-01 10:26:47 +00:00
Florian Mayer
411d78c06c Fix typo in MemtagHelper
Bug: 280034968
Change-Id: I5977925399342cd79f0bed2dd4af0e21c0c20102
2023-05-01 10:25:04 +00:00
Chaohui Wang
ca615997ea Use string notifications_disabled instead of off
notifications_disabled was changed to off in
Change: I5f84d09f223efd478461ded93aeac82bf7b128d8

And reverted from off to notifications_disabled in
Change: Iaad301c5513478fb95e40987ea3ccb4f923d71fa

This usage is branched from AppNotificationPreferenceController.java,
and missed in revert.

Bug: 272603842
Test: Visual
Test: Unit test
Change-Id: I5b8466134c1342e10de7a2ead8c52931e0c19377
2023-04-29 15:42:09 +08:00
Grace Cheng
ec1bd37db0 Prevent NPE on deleting fingerprint in Settings
Gate all Settings FingerprintUnlockCategory logic on isSfps() check to prevent NPE

Fixes: 279866500
Test: Enroll 2+ fingerprints on a non-sfps device, delete fingerprint,
observe no crash

Change-Id: I040d498426e0f8efb789875eedeb7bcf44436149
2023-04-29 05:19:41 +00:00
Treehugger Robot
fa4f628318 Merge "Add developer option switch to set ANGLE as the default system driver" into udc-dev am: 24666c9737 am: 7dfd217c1e
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/22542821

Change-Id: I3b39848e791168df59d4f2203f59ae14728069df
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-04-29 04:36:52 +00:00
Treehugger Robot
24666c9737 Merge "Add developer option switch to set ANGLE as the default system driver" into udc-dev 2023-04-29 03:21:56 +00:00
Becca Hughes
7fdbfc7b0e Revert "Rollback decision to merge by package name"
This reverts commit ca542c90cd.

Reason for revert: product changed mind

Change-Id: Ic4b9275e8f19bf2b3e3e51f09162fb6d45e6a5bf
2023-04-28 21:06:00 +00:00
Julia Tuttle
a4877c4410 Merge "Fix a couple compiler warnings in Settings" into udc-dev am: 7b3df1c080 am: e35f0679e3
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/22897913

Change-Id: I119564fb748f9fc4f8b0bf533a3fe988bdfb7165
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-04-28 19:19:15 +00:00
Julia Tuttle
4693fb2f9d Merge "Optimize imports in AppNotificationSettings" into udc-dev am: ec12caadda am: c8d12d6b34
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/22897912

Change-Id: I13e3b9fedb2e0bed3156e22eab3f1ef982630973
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-04-28 19:18:39 +00:00
Austin Delgado
4d53fc2add Merge "Hide enrollment options that don't match requested biometric strength" into udc-dev am: 9b94905c63 am: 01570d3bfc
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/22646172

Change-Id: I3130c2ec0a3aa653a11fd211ab4d7a3c411e7fc0
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-04-28 19:15:41 +00:00
Julia Tuttle
7b3df1c080 Merge "Fix a couple compiler warnings in Settings" into udc-dev 2023-04-28 18:42:23 +00:00
Yuxin Hu
25b270c0f8 Add developer option switch to set ANGLE as the default system driver
This change adds a new developer option switch called
"Enable ANGLE". It defaults to off. User can choose
to toggle it on and off, and the value of the system
property "persist.graphics.egl" is changed accordingly:

switch off: persist.graphics.egl=""
switch on: persist.graphics.egl="angle"

When user toggles the switch, a reboot window is
popped up asking user to reboot now to make the change
takes effect. If user chooses to cancel the reboot,
the switch is toggled back. This enforces that a reboot
is required whenever the "persis.graphics.egl" value
changes.

Upon reboot, we will load either ANGLE or native
GLES driver as the system driver, based on the value of
"persist.graphics.egl".

The switch is disabled if ANGLE is not installed
in /vendor partition. We use the system property
"ro.gfx.angle.supported" as an indicator. We set the
two conditions together in angle.mk file. Any device
mk file that inherits angle.mk file will result in
ANGLE libs installed in /vendor and "ro.gfx.angle.supported"
set to true.

Bug: b/270994705
Test: m; flash and check Pixel 7 boots fine
atest SettingsRoboTests:GraphicsDriverEnableAngleAsSystemDriverControllerTest

Change-Id: I565eff614472bb6ba50742e7dfa49b50dca2809f
2023-04-28 18:42:10 +00:00
Julia Tuttle
75f566bce9 Fix a couple compiler warnings in Settings
Bug: 277938609
Test: builds
Change-Id: Ib5e236220dfcfddec60c9277d06ffbde9645bb73
2023-04-28 18:19:30 +00:00
Julia Tuttle
ec12caadda Merge "Optimize imports in AppNotificationSettings" into udc-dev 2023-04-28 18:18:40 +00:00
Austin Delgado
9b94905c63 Merge "Hide enrollment options that don't match requested biometric strength" into udc-dev 2023-04-28 17:42:46 +00:00
Chaohui Wang
faf4b81386 Merge "Fix ImeiInfoPreferenceControllerTest" into udc-dev am: fec25d4bad am: 6d591f5b5c am: a6d606f278
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/22896675

Change-Id: Ie929c6eec8c4c612bee99fcc9b3face303baf08e
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-04-28 14:03:28 +00:00
Chaohui Wang
a6d606f278 Merge "Fix ImeiInfoPreferenceControllerTest" into udc-dev am: fec25d4bad am: 6d591f5b5c
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/22896675

Change-Id: Id9c80b73953e39623dbf9ee2bdc4a670c0eb5d3b
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-04-28 13:13:31 +00:00
Chaohui Wang
fec25d4bad Merge "Fix ImeiInfoPreferenceControllerTest" into udc-dev 2023-04-28 11:52:50 +00:00
Treehugger Robot
060a56468d Merge "Revert "Back up the smooth display setting"" into udc-dev 2023-04-28 09:58:16 +00:00
Treehugger Robot
186b9ef5b5 Merge "[BiometricsV2] Fix fingerprint 2nd enroll fail" 2023-04-28 08:05:45 +00:00
Chaohui Wang
8470122ad1 Fix ImeiInfoPreferenceControllerTest
For test case updatePreference_simSlotWithoutSim_notSetEnabled,
mSecondSimPreference is a mock, instead of check the default value of
isEnabled(), verify it's setEnabled() not called.

Fix: 279880808
Test: RobolectricTest
Change-Id: I72064820754e053def46bdbf10317189c7ac608f
2023-04-28 15:53:44 +08:00
Treehugger Robot
9ed2ac48fb Merge "[Settings] Update code owner" am: 709b27384b am: c40b06b687 am: a6f0662924 am: 0469be62f0 am: 82296631cd
Original change: https://android-review.googlesource.com/c/platform/packages/apps/Settings/+/2527125

Change-Id: I81730fe484cd19aec2a97e43f2f4d7e57ec4672a
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-04-28 05:53:26 +00:00
Tom Hsu
c3f08dcf56 Merge "[Settings] UI part: Add metrics for language" into udc-dev am: bd9263b391 am: 2bc75c0d5d
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/22788844

Change-Id: Id8451b6b130cfccca0061f8aa9529c0783635641
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-04-28 04:06:33 +00:00
Tom Hsu
1e2ecf3e2e Merge "[Settings] UI part: Add metrics for language" into udc-dev am: bd9263b391 am: 39b150171b
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/22788844

Change-Id: Id2f4e945fc893315f15f4f58e0f114187b5edb19
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-04-28 04:06:24 +00:00
Tom Hsu
39b150171b Merge "[Settings] UI part: Add metrics for language" into udc-dev am: bd9263b391
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/22788844

Change-Id: I49425eb7c992008e5dc7f0d028c82e4bee41038e
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-04-28 03:23:39 +00:00
Tom Hsu
bd9263b391 Merge "[Settings] UI part: Add metrics for language" into udc-dev 2023-04-28 02:49:59 +00:00
Julia Tuttle
3a68e5bf28 Optimize imports in AppNotificationSettings
Bug: 277938609
Test: builds
Change-Id: Id44390f6fc8b6294c951a7f4ec9bd37e0a364dfd
2023-04-27 17:24:14 -04:00
Piotr Wilczyński
9797fc8d15 Merge "Revert "Back up the smooth display setting"" into udc-d1-dev am: 0066bdea3e
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/22848698

Change-Id: I3f3058996ac6418ce8df4e888b0959830276ac31
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-04-27 20:53:05 +00:00
TreeHugger Robot
f48a328ac8 Merge "Fixed speed selection lost when changing password in Wi-Fi hotspot settings" into udc-dev am: 32602794ed am: 9e2e3e9ae6
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/22885040

Change-Id: Ib258aa7845d1da749b43cce636a489a8d844322e
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-04-27 20:22:17 +00:00
TreeHugger Robot
bb49ef02f9 Merge "Fixed speed selection lost when changing password in Wi-Fi hotspot settings" into udc-dev am: 32602794ed am: d1ebd886db
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/22885040

Change-Id: I7007257549a53aabbede5faed635066bb8f82a85
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-04-27 20:22:15 +00:00
TreeHugger Robot
9e2e3e9ae6 Merge "Fixed speed selection lost when changing password in Wi-Fi hotspot settings" into udc-dev am: 32602794ed
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/22885040

Change-Id: I16732ae62948cd37f654d03739fc21973f9c754a
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-04-27 19:25:08 +00:00
Treehugger Robot
82296631cd Merge "[Settings] Update code owner" am: 709b27384b am: c40b06b687 am: a6f0662924 am: 0469be62f0
Original change: https://android-review.googlesource.com/c/platform/packages/apps/Settings/+/2527125

Change-Id: Ib86e796a246d7112adce01f229771fbb40e4f70d
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-04-27 19:09:09 +00:00
TreeHugger Robot
32602794ed Merge "Fixed speed selection lost when changing password in Wi-Fi hotspot settings" into udc-dev 2023-04-27 18:55:20 +00:00
Treehugger Robot
0469be62f0 Merge "[Settings] Update code owner" am: 709b27384b am: c40b06b687 am: a6f0662924
Original change: https://android-review.googlesource.com/c/platform/packages/apps/Settings/+/2527125

Change-Id: I63b80b09c29c9d41f7b950c7a63955088e17824e
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-04-27 18:02:40 +00:00
Becca Hughes
3107fb0f96 DO NOT MERGE Hide provider from this list if autofill provider am: 99f1d5448d
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/22792839

Change-Id: Ifde2d297be711a957ce900ec5c7f1d30601bc6ee
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-04-27 17:11:36 +00:00
Becca Hughes
c6a74847e4 DO NOT MERGE Hide provider from this list if autofill provider am: 99f1d5448d
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/22792839

Change-Id: I79a8f47acb16ac995333c7c40a0309c83e67404c
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-04-27 17:09:06 +00:00
Becca Hughes
a620612b9f DO NOT MERGE Listen for updates to autofill/credman provider am: 688b023d09
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/22764836

Change-Id: I0e113f37760847067042e41dd1a3e48d398c0270
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-04-27 17:06:41 +00:00
Becca Hughes
7378d6c66c DO NOT MERGE Listen for updates to autofill/credman provider am: 688b023d09
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/22764836

Change-Id: I2c3cdf15907f2e6e2a40a2547b9b6b92cdcfd35c
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-04-27 17:04:31 +00:00